My Dell vostro A840 Laptop shuts off after 5 seconds that I have turned it on, the blue light showing that is has turned. The screen is black, I don't even get the boot up screen. What will I do. thanks

Need to reinstall windows, insert your windows disk and boot from it.
If that does not work buy/get a new AC adapter and/or battery.
if that gets you no where open the case area around the fan use a can of compressed air n blow it all out.

My Dell vostro A860 Laptop shuts off after 5 seconds that I have turned it on, the blue light showing that is has turned. The screen is black, I don't even get the boot up screen. What will I do. thanks

Enter to bios after powering and watch if it still go off. If not, go to Healt or sensors section and watch the temperature of CPU and system. The computer might turn off because of overheating.

The button is on and the lock 9 is on and flashing and the screen is black. It was working fine. I opened the laptop and my screen is black. The A in the lock is blue and the icon next to it. The power...

Hold the power button for 5 seconds or more - does it turn off properly? If so, can you turn it back on afterwards?

Take out the battery and unplug the power adaptor. Let it sit for a few minutes. Now try the power adaptor alone. If this works, try shutting down and running on battery again.
